Blog

The Ultimate 5Step Guide To Creating Your Unity Catalog Today

The Ultimate 5Step Guide To Creating Your Unity Catalog Today
The Ultimate 5Step Guide To Creating Your Unity Catalog Today

Get Started with Unity Catalog: A Comprehensive Guide

Learning Unity 5 Step 1 The Art Of Game Design

In today's data-driven world, managing and organizing your data assets efficiently is crucial. Unity Catalog, a powerful tool within the Databricks platform, offers a secure and collaborative way to centralize and govern your data. This guide will walk you through the process of creating your Unity Catalog, empowering you to unlock the full potential of your data.

Step 1: Understanding Unity Catalog

Design The Ultimate 5Step Guide To Salt Lake City Today Data Science

Unity Catalog is a metadata management and data governance solution that enables you to securely share and collaborate on data across your organization. It provides a unified view of your data assets, allowing for efficient data discovery and access control. With Unity Catalog, you can:

  • Centralize data discovery and access.
  • Implement fine-grained access controls.
  • Ensure data security and compliance.
  • Enable collaboration and data sharing.

Step 2: Creating a Unity Catalog

The Ultimate 5Step Guide To Designing Your Special Forces Today Excel Web

To create a Unity Catalog, you'll need to follow these steps:

  1. Log in to your Databricks workspace.
  2. Navigate to the Admin tab and select Unity Catalog from the sidebar.
  3. Click on the Create Catalog button.
  4. Provide a Name and an optional Description for your catalog.
  5. Choose a Metastore for your catalog. You can either use an existing metastore or create a new one.
  6. Review and confirm the details, then click Create.

Light Bulb Note: Metastore is a critical component of Unity Catalog, storing metadata about your data assets. Ensure you have a suitable metastore in place before creating your catalog.

Step 3: Defining Schemas and Tables

Unity Catalog Setup Instructions

Once you have created your Unity Catalog, you'll need to define the schemas and tables that will hold your data. Here's how:

  1. Navigate to your newly created catalog.
  2. Click on the Create Schema button.
  3. Provide a Name and an optional Description for your schema.
  4. Choose the Storage Location for your schema. This is the path where your data will be stored.
  5. Review and confirm the details, then click Create.
  6. To create a table within your schema, navigate to the schema and click on the Create Table button. Provide the necessary details, such as the table name, columns, and data types.

Step 4: Granting Access and Setting Permissions

Ppt The Ultimate 5 Step Guide To Seo In 2021 Rs Digital Marketing

Unity Catalog allows you to control access to your data assets with fine-grained permissions. Here's how to grant access and set permissions:

  1. Navigate to the Unity Catalog dashboard.
  2. Select the Principals tab.
  3. Click on the Create Principal button.
  4. Provide a Name and an optional Description for your principal (e.g., a user, group, or service principal).
  5. Choose the Type of principal (e.g., User, Group, or Service Principal).
  6. Review and confirm the details, then click Create.
  7. To grant access to a principal, navigate to the relevant catalog, schema, or table, and click on the Permissions tab. Here, you can add the principal and assign the desired permissions (e.g., SELECT, INSERT, UPDATE, DELETE).

Step 5: Connecting to Your Data

The Ultimate 5 Step Guide To Landing Your First Scrum Role What Is Scrum

Once you have created your Unity Catalog and defined the necessary schemas and tables, you'll need to connect to your data. Here's how:

  1. Log in to your Databricks workspace.
  2. Navigate to the Data tab and select Unity Catalog from the sidebar.
  3. Locate your Unity Catalog and expand it to view the available schemas and tables.
  4. Click on the desired table to view its data.
  5. You can also use SQL queries to interact with your data. Click on the Query button next to the table to open a SQL editor.

Additional Tips

Guide To Setting Up Unity Catalog In Databricks Tredence Blog
  • Unity Catalog supports various data sources, including Delta Lake, Hive Metastore, and AWS Glue. Choose the data source that aligns with your requirements.
  • Consider using Delta Lake with Unity Catalog for its advanced data management features, such as ACID transactions and time travel.
  • Regularly review and update your access controls and permissions to ensure data security and compliance.

Conclusion

The Ultimate 5Step Guide To Creating Descriptive Statistics In Excel

Creating a Unity Catalog is a powerful step towards efficient data management and collaboration. By following this guide, you can establish a secure and organized data environment, enabling your team to unlock the full potential of your data assets. Remember to regularly maintain and update your Unity Catalog to ensure optimal performance and security.





What is Unity Catalog and why is it important?

Unity Catalog Best Practices Databricks Documentation

+


Unity Catalog is a metadata management and data governance solution within the Databricks platform. It provides a secure and collaborative way to centralize and govern data assets, enabling efficient data discovery and access control.






How do I create a Unity Catalog?

Create The Ultimate 5Step Guide Now Excel Web

+


To create a Unity Catalog, log in to your Databricks workspace, navigate to the Admin tab, select Unity Catalog, and click Create Catalog. Provide a name and description, choose a metastore, and confirm the details.






What are schemas and tables in Unity Catalog?

The Ultimate 5Step Guide To Creating Your Wild Geese Poem Today

+


Schemas and tables are containers for your data assets within Unity Catalog. Schemas organize related tables, while tables store your actual data. You can define schemas and tables to structure your data efficiently.






How do I grant access and set permissions in Unity Catalog?

What Is Unity Catalog Databricks On Aws

+


To grant access and set permissions, navigate to the Unity Catalog dashboard, select the Principals tab, create a principal (e.g., user, group, or service principal), and assign the desired permissions (e.g., SELECT, INSERT, UPDATE, DELETE) to the relevant catalog, schema, or table.






How do I connect to my data in Unity Catalog?

Databricks Unity Catalog Everything You Need To Know

+


To connect to your data, log in to your Databricks workspace, navigate to the Data tab, select Unity Catalog, locate your Unity Catalog, expand it to view schemas and tables, and click on the desired table to view its data. You can also use SQL queries to interact with your data.





Related Articles

Back to top button